C# and .NET development team leader - medical laboratory instrumentation

Based in Innsbruck in the heart of the Tyrolean alps, Oroboros is a world leader in instrumentation for mitochondrial respirometry. We are offering an exciting opportunity for a senior C# and .NET developer to lead the team developing a new generation of software to support our highly successful instruments.

The ideal candidate will have substantial experience leading a software team in the development of desktop scientific applications. The vision for the future of OROBOROS INSTRUMENTS is an open architecture that allows open and flexible access to real-time and historic data from scientific experiments, on-site and across the internet. Therefore, a knowledge of secure real-time networking, cloud computing and cloud hosted databases is of advantage, as is an understanding of data analytics and statistics for time-series analysis. Some knowledge of laboratory and medical instrumentation is beneficial, but not essential.

The successful candidate will join the international Oroboros-team at the beginning of this exciting new chapter in our history. Based in Innsbruck, he or she will have the opportunity to build and lead a software team that will greatly influence our future success, and will become a part of the international scientific community in mitochondrial respirometry.

The salary is performance-oriented according to the Austrian wage agreement (Kollektivvertrag fΓΌr Angestellte und Lehrlinge in Handelsbetrieben), commensurate with experience and qualification.


Bioinformatics

Within the K-Regio project MitoFit, we offer a full-time position in Workpackage 2. The position in the 3-year project is open for permanent contination (OROBOROS INSTRUMENTS) and is closely linked to the COST Action MITOEAGLE.
  • Workpackage 2: Our goal is to establish an integration and analysis environment for measurements of mitochondrial respiration (O2k-technology) with external data (cell physiology, anthropometry, spiroergometry, lifestyle, genomics) in the context of fitness evaluation and clinical diagnostics. Within the scope of the MitoFit project, a Knowledge Management Platform (MitoFit-KMP) will be established. This KMP will accomplish the integration of all relevant data and provide a presentation platform for mitochondrial functional diagnostics. The MitoFit-KMP will include: a data management system for the current and planned instruments (MitoFit-DMS), and a database (MitoFit-DB) comprising proprietary and publicly available data that allow researchers to query experimental data and perform integrative analyses. Closely linked to WP1, a strategy will be developed on the transition of the DatLab software from a continuously updated and extended research tool to a component of the O2k as a medical device.
